GONZO Announces Upcoming Release of "SAMURAI RELIGION" Video

Animation powerhouse GONZO has disclosed plans to unveil a new video titled "SAMURAI RELIGION," set to premiere on their YouTube channel on October 15. Directed by Ai Yokoyama, a skilled animator known for her work on notable projects such as the "Space Battleship Tiramisu" and the "Bayonetta: Bloody Fate" film, the video also features her innovative storyboard contributions.

The "SAMURAI RELIGION" presentation will include a character song performed by AI singer Topaz. This particular composition, featuring collaborative efforts with artists Nozomi Tanabe, Mikey, B Swamp, and Mayuko Kubota, is titled "Gloria." Topaz represents a significant leap in digital creativity, having been developed using advanced AI singing software from the GEMVOX initiative.

Introduced in 2021, the "SAMURAI cryptos" project aims to revolutionize animation in the NFT landscape by showcasing the essence of Japanese samurai culture. GONZO's president, Shinichiro Ichikawa, emphasizes a vision for a digital future anchored in themes of "Cypher," "Decentral," and "Solidarity." The project boasts contributions from a talented roster of designers, including renowned names such as Makoto Kobayashi and Range Murata.

Founded by former Gainax members in 1992, GONZO has undergone numerous transformations, including a merge with Digimation and restructuring efforts leading to their current status under Asatsu-DK's management.
